## Sweeper runbook

Quick heads-up before you poke at ScrubCycle, our data-retention sweeper: it runs nightly and hard-deletes anything past policy age, so don't test against the production bucket. For review purposes, the interesting bits are the age thresholds and the exclusion list — those are where past audits found drift. The dry-run flag is honored everywhere except the archive tier, which is a known wart we're tracking. Here's what the sweeper currently runs with.

settings of yageg-yahap:
[gorael]
team = olieth
access_code = ac_941d74
owner = brieth.aldiel
host = gorael.tolvaqio.internal
port = 6379
peer = briwyn.urlaqtech.internal
salt = 116e6622
pin = 1957

## Changelog — glimmerd v2.8.1

Key rotation for the glimmerd metrics-aggregation sidecar. Old signing key retired after the Pellwick incident review; all sidecar builds from v2.8.1 onward are signed with the new key. Scrape configs unchanged. Aggregation windows and flush intervals unchanged. New team members: update your local verification keyring before pulling images, or the admission hook will reject the sidecar at deploy time. Builds older than v2.6 are no longer trusted. Verify all v2.8.1+ artifacts against the key below.

deploy key for kahof-tadup: bky4_rRMZ

## Sensor drift: what to do at 3am

If the GrowLoop controller starts reporting humidity swings that don't match the backup probes in the Fernwick greenhouse, it's almost always sensor drift, not an actual climate event. Don't panic and don't touch the vents manually. First, restart the calibration daemon and give it ten minutes to re-baseline. If readings still disagree by more than 5%, flip the controller into safe mode. The safe-mode thresholds it will use are these.

config for yahap-bajof:
[istix]
host = istix.qorvelsys.internal
user = istix_svc
database = istix_prod

**Q: Why does the markdown pipeline strip my custom HTML blocks?**

The Inkmill renderer sanitizes raw HTML by default for security. Allowed tags are defined in the pipeline config, not per-document. To request an addition, open a ticket against the rendering config with a justification; changes ship in the weekly release. For anything blocking a release, email the pipeline maintainers directly.

alerts address for yajof-kahog: eliax@qirvanlabs.corp